PGL confirmed on March 6th, 2025, that ATOX has been banned from competing in their events due to a provisional suspension from ESIC. ATOX is also banned from the BLAST Open Lisbon tournament, with the suspension linked to an ongoing investigation. While ESIC has not revealed the specifics, it is rumored that ATOX is under investigation for suspected match-fixing during Season 20 of the ESL Pro League.
The investigation could take several weeks, according to Chinese Counter-Strike 2 commentator Yunqing ‘Searph‘ Hu. Organizers of future events involving ATOX have been made aware of the situation and are preparing for the possibility of the team being banned permanently. ESIC, which enforces integrity within esports, has a history of punishing misconduct.

In March, ESIC imposed a three-year ban on Ukrainian player Ilya ‘Ganginho‘ Chernychenko for violating betting and corruption rules. With the investigation into ATOX still ongoing, it remains uncertain how long they will be barred from competing in tournaments organized by ESIC members. If found guilty, ATOX could face a lengthy suspension, possibly lasting years, before returning to top-tier Counter-Strike esports.
